The authors of Cobar’s Lodes of Gold book, former local residents Craig and Therese Stegman, have been invited as guest speakers for this year’s Night for our Lost Miners event.

The Night for our Lost Miners memorial event pays tribute to Cobar’s lost miners and is now commemorated each year as part of Cobar’s Festival of the Miner’s Ghost activities.

Craig and Therese were thrilled with the invitation and are excited about returning to Cobar next month.

The pair are both trained geologists and met in Cobar in 1988 when they were working for a short time at the CSA Mine.

They headed in different directions but later married in 1990.

They returned to Cobar in 1995 with Craig working at the Peak Gold Mine and Therese at Elura with Pasminco.

Therese said they have many fond memories of Cobar where they lived for nearly nine years, started their family, made lifelong friends and they were also actively involved in much of the modern history of the Cobar mines.

Their parting gift to the community was Lodes of Gold which tells the story of Cobar’s rich mining heritage.
